About this course

In an era where reconciliation and decolonization are at the forefront of societal discussions, there is increasing demand for educators who possess a deep understanding of Indigenous knowledge systems. By enrolling in this course, learners will develop essential skills to meet this demand, enhancing their career prospects in education and related fields. Throughout the program, participants will engage in critical discourse, learn from Indigenous knowledge holders, and examine practical applications of Indigenous pedagogies. By the end, learners will be equipped with the necessary skills to create supportive learning environments that honor Indigenous ways of knowing, thereby contributing to the broader goal of reconciliation and cultural revitalization.

Career Path

In the UK, there is a growing demand for professionals with an Executive Certificate in Indigenous Knowledge Systems in Education. The following roles are among the most sought after, featuring a diverse range of responsibilities and salary ranges. 1. **Education Consultant**: These professionals work closely with educational institutions to develop and implement Indigenous knowledge systems in education policies and curricula. The average salary range for this role is Β£35,000 to Β£60,000 per year. 2. **Indigenous Curriculum Developer**: Curriculum developers create engaging and inclusive educational materials that incorporate Indigenous knowledge systems, fostering cultural awareness and understanding. Their annual salary ranges from Β£30,000 to Β£50,000. 3. **Community Outreach Coordinator**: These professionals ensure strong connections between educational institutions and Indigenous communities, organizing events and workshops that promote cultural exchange. The average salary range for this role is Β£25,000 to Β£40,000 per year. 4. **Cultural Liaison Officer**: Cultural liaison officers serve as a bridge between educational institutions and Indigenous communities, addressing cultural sensitivities and ensuring respectful collaboration. They typically earn between Β£22,000 and Β£35,000 per year. 5. **Traditional Knowledge Keeper**: Traditional knowledge keepers share their wisdom and experiences to enrich educational programs and inspire new generations. These individuals are often compensated on a project basis, with fees ranging from Β£15,000 to Β£30,000 per year. Incorporating Indigenous knowledge systems into education is a growing trend in the UK, with numerous exciting opportunities for professionals with the right skills and training.
